Cantu Shea Butter Leave-In Conditioning Mist Review: A Curly-Hair Staple Worth the Hype?

Cantu built its name specifically around curly and coily hair care, and the Shea Butter Leave-In Conditioning Mist is one of the brand’s most repurchased products — a lighter, spray-on alternative to the brand’s heavier creams, meant for daily refresh rather than a full wash-day styling step.

The mist format is the key difference from most leave-ins: it distributes shea butter evenly in a lighter delivery, which matters for curl types that get weighed down easily by thicker leave-in creams.

As a daily refresher, it’s most often used to revive second- or third-day curls that have started to dry out or frizz, misted in and scrunched to bring definition back without a full restyle. It also works well as the leave-in step right after washing, before styling cream or gel goes on top.

Verified Amazon.ae buyers with type 3 and 4 curl patterns consistently mention it as one of the few leave-ins that actually detangles without heavy pulling, and several use it specifically for their children’s curly hair because of the gentle, sulfate-free formula. Very fine, looser wave patterns occasionally find it too light to hold definition on its own and pair it with a stronger gel.

For coily and curly hair specifically, it holds up to its reputation as a reliable daily-use product rather than a trend — the shea butter formula and mist delivery solve a real problem (moisture without weight) that a lot of leave-ins get wrong.
